Output 66938976c3c8ac848f5f9035b8b1adcaab4b217656e1395a32da4c1db6ff2328:11
- value
- 23243965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9506e395780e1724032f87f96e1f536f93fc726f OP_EQUAL
- address
- 3FGzrnLncxBadWUNh5pirPV8DDyoXJLH8s
- transaction
- 66938976c3c8ac848f5f9035b8b1adcaab4b217656e1395a32da4c1db6ff2328
- confirmations
- 156179
- spent
- true